// iOS Card // -------------------------------------------------- $card-ios-margin-top: 16px !default; $card-ios-margin-right: 16px !default; $card-ios-margin-bottom: 16px !default; $card-ios-margin-left: 16px !default; $card-ios-background-color: $list-background-color !default; $card-ios-box-shadow: 0 1px 2px rgba(0,0,0,.3) !default; $card-ios-border-radius: 2px !default; $card-ios-font-size: 1.4rem !default; $card-ios-title-font-size: 1.8rem !default; $card-ios-title-padding: 8px 0 8px 0; $card-ios-title-text-color: #222 !default; .card.list[mode=ios] { margin: $card-ios-margin-top $card-ios-margin-right $card-ios-margin-bottom $card-ios-margin-left; background: $card-ios-background-color; box-shadow: $card-ios-box-shadow; border-radius: $card-ios-border-radius; font-size: $card-ios-font-size; overflow: hidden; .item:first-child { margin-top: 0; } .item:last-child { margin-bottom: 0; } .item:first-child:before, .item:last-child:after { border: none; } .item::before, .item::after { left: 0; } .card-title { padding: $card-ios-title-padding; font-size: $card-ios-title-font-size; color: $card-ios-title-text-color; } } .card.list[mode=ios] + .card { margin-top: 0; }